字节国际化直播(C++/GO)一面面经

自我介绍
介绍一下实习内容:(kafka相关)
接到需求以后是怎么考虑的,有什么要注意的地方;
遇到的技术问题是什么,怎么解决的?
kafka数据不丢怎么保证(业务不需要保证,但是也回答了多副本写入保证不丢的配置)。

---
进程和线程是什么
什么是线程池
用线程池可以解决你上面遇到的技术问题吗?

---
http和https描述一下
tls握手过程
非对称加密
非对称加密除了性能问题还会有什么问题吗

---
MySQL了解过吗,了解过的都说一下
说了索引,b+树等等;
最左匹配原则了解过吗(这里没答好),索引匹配是要找最优的还是要找符合条件的索引;

---
令牌桶了解过吗?(没有)
为了保证服务不会被一个时间内大量的请求打挂,有什么办法(说了代理IP限制,对每个请求有独特的ID,然后通过hash等方式去不同的服务器去处理)
然后面试官说你答的是负载均衡的场景,我说的是负载均衡后面的那一步的场景,然后就没继续了。

---
做题,最近公共祖先节点。(本来还要自己建树,时间不够了就没建了)
给出的节点如果不在树里面怎么判断(笨办法,dfs一次不在直接返回nullptr,其他没想出来了)

#字节跳动内推提前批##字节跳动##面经#
全部评论
"为了保证服务不会被一个时间内大量的请求打挂"说的是SYN攻击吗
点赞 回复 分享
发布于 2021-08-05 17:55
请问lz收到二面了吗
点赞 回复 分享
发布于 2021-08-08 20:50
令牌桶是限流的算法吧
点赞 回复 分享
发布于 2021-10-02 17:15

相关推荐

1 29 评论
分享
牛客网
牛客企业服务